What You'll Do

  • Sustain 24/7 production operations for high-volume automated manufacturing systems by rapidly diagnosing and resolving mechanical, electrical, and control system failures to minimize unplanned downtime
  • Develop, debug, and document PLC code on Siemens S7-1200 and S7-1500, Allen-Bradley ControlLogix/CompactLogix, and Beckhoff TwinCAT 3 platforms to control robots, conveyors, and third-party equipment
  • Program, teach, and commission industrial 6-axis robots including Fanuc, Kuka, Durr, Cartesian, and SCARA systems for complex multi-station automation tasks
  • Design and implement 2D and 3D vision systems for part detection, alignment, and quality verification in high-speed production environments
  • Lead the integration and calibration of gantry systems, including precision positioning, motion control, and synchronization with robotic and conveyor systems
  • Design and implement fixturing and calibration solutions using GD&T principles to ensure repeatability, accuracy, and process capability
  • Integrate and commission laser welding systems, with Trumpf experience preferred, including setup, parameter tuning, and process validation
  • Support and maintain mechanical press systems, including Kistler load cells and force monitoring, and troubleshoot pneumatic, hydraulic, and servo-driven systems
  • Implement FDS) and Atlas Copco fastening systems, including tool calibration, process validation, and integration with PLC and HMI
  • Conduct formal risk assessments and implement ANSI/RIA R15.06 and OSHA-compliant safety systems, including light curtains, safety relays, emergency stops, and safe motion control
